Program Analysis

Graduates of the Special Education and Teaching program at Minnesota State University-Mankato earn more than the national average for this major. One year after graduation, the average salary is $56,364, which is higher than the national average of $53,218. Five years after graduation, the average salary is $52,961.

The program has a debt-to-earnings ratio of zero. Graduates report no debt.

The program graduates 34 students per year.
